Swiss Watch Gallery and Fine Jewelry has introduced on-site jewelry repair and design services at its Brea showroom, expanding its luxury offerings beyond timepieces. A master jeweler is available Tuesday through Friday from 10:30 am to 5:30 pm, providing clients with direct access to expert craftsmanship without the typical delays associated with off-site repairs.
The service begins with complimentary jewelry cleaning and inspection, allowing clients to maintain their cherished pieces at optimal condition. Many repairs can be completed while clients shop the boutique or enjoy dining within the mall, depending on complexity. Services include professional polishing, ring sizing, rhodium plating, re-tipping of prongs, chain soldering, and stone resetting, all performed with the precision expected of a luxury jeweler.
For personalization, engraving services are available with a one-week turnaround. The Brea showroom also offers jewelry redesign, where treasured heirlooms can be transformed into contemporary creations. Additionally, clients can commission bespoke, one-of-a-kind custom jewelry crafted in partnership with the jeweler to reflect individual vision. This exclusive offering is available only at Swiss Watch Gallery and Fine Jewelry's Brea location.
The expansion into comprehensive jewelry services represents a strategic move for the retailer, which has operated for four decades with locations in both the Shops at Mission Viejo and Brea Mall. As one of the largest dealers of complicated timepieces on the West Coast, the company carries over 30 premier Swiss and German watch brands including Rolex, TUDOR, Omega, Cartier, Breitling and TAG Heuer. The new jewelry services complement their existing watch repair expertise, creating a full-service luxury destination.
